‘He didn’t call glass, he called game!’: Jayson Tatum hits incredible stepback over Giannis, leads Celtics to 122-121 win over Bucks
Jayson Tatum hit one of the biggest shots of his career with an amazingly clutch stepback 3-pointer over tight defense from Giannis.
The Celtics started the 4th quarter off with a sizeable 17-point lead. Giannis then had 10 points within the first 4 minutes of the period. This forced the Celtics to take 2 timeouts they wouldn’t otherwise have used.
The Celtics’ lead went from 17 to 0 as the Bucks tied the game up at 109 each. Jrue Holiday then gave the Bucks a lead with 1:10 remaining in the game with a stepback 3 from the left wing. This took the scores to 120-119 in the Bucks’ favor.
Both teams traded missed buckets after that, with Theis and Jaylen Brown both missing wide open 3s for the Cs. Jeff Teague had a stupendous deflection on a fast break by Donte DiVincenzo that gave the Celtics the ball back.
Jayson Tatum hits step-back gamewinner over Giannis
With 8.9 seconds left in the game, Giannis fouled Jaylen Brown and allowed the Celtics to regroup. Their final play was just to give Tatum the ball, hope and pray he did the rest. And boy, did that pay off for them!

Tatum danced on Giannis on the left wing, saw the opportunity to take a 3-pointer and took it, despite the Celtics only needing a 2 for the lead. The reach of Giannis is so big that Tatum, however, had to bank the ball in. It was an incredible shot in every sense of the word, and quite the opening night of the season for Boston.
The Bucks had a chance to tie the game after Giannis was fouled on an inbounds pass by Tristan Thompson with 0.4 seconds left. But the Greek Freak missed his second free throw after making one, and the shot clock expired. This gave the Cs a famous, morale-boosting win to start the season off.
